Smulation and Test Study of Grey Predictive-Fuzzy Control for Magneto-rheological Suspension

Abstract: Abstract: For purpose of improving the vibration absorption effect of magneto-rheological (MR) suspension sysytem, the bench test of response characteristic both in time and frequency domain have been done for the special magneto-rheological (MR) damper. Then a grey predictive-fuzzy controller(GPFC)is proposed by integrating the grey predictive theory and the traditional fuzzy control(TFC) algorithm and is applied to the control system of MR suspension . Inorder to verify the effectiveness of the proposed control strategy, the comparative study of simultion and bentch test among sky-hook control, TFC and GPFC has been presented. The results show that the response speed of MR damper is fast, the bend of frequency response is wide. Both the simulation and test results present that the performance of the GPFC is the best, the time response is superior to that of TFC, but slower than that of sky-hook control
